How much do part time shuttle bus driver j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time shuttle bus driver in DeKalb County, GA is $20.05,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.40 and $21.73 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a part time shuttle bus driver do?

A part time shuttle bus driver is responsible for safely transporting passengers along a designated route, typically on a set schedule. They may drive for airports, hotels, campuses, or businesses, handling pick-ups and drop-offs at specific locations. Duties include assisting passengers, performing safety checks on the vehicle, and ensuring compliance with traffic laws and company policies. Good customer service skills and a clean driving record are essential for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time shuttle bus driver?

To thrive as a Part Time Shuttle Bus Driver, you generally need a valid commercial driver's license (CDL), a clean driving record, and knowledge of safe driving practices.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, vehicle inspection protocols, and sometimes training in passenger assistance or first aid is typically required. Excellent customer service, patience, and strong communication skills help drivers interact effectively with passengers and handle unexpected situations. These skills and qualifications ensure passenger safety, reliable service, and a positive experience for both riders and employers.

What is the difference between Part Time Shuttle Bus Driver vs Part Time Bus Driver?

AspectPart Time Shuttle Bus DriverPart Time Bus Driver
CredentialsValid driver's license, passenger endorsement (if required)Valid driver's license, passenger endorsement (if required)
Work EnvironmentShuttle services within specific locations like airports, hotels, or campusesPublic transit, school buses, or private bus services
Employer & IndustryTransportation companies, institutions, or private organizationsPublic transit agencies, schools, or private bus companies
Search & Comparison IntentOften compared for local, short-distance driving rolesBroader bus driving roles including longer routes

In summary, Part Time Shuttle Bus Drivers typically operate within specific locations like airports or campuses, focusing on short-distance, scheduled routes. Part Time Bus Drivers may cover a wider range of routes, including longer distances and different environments. Both roles require similar licensing and safety standards but differ mainly in scope and work setting.

How to be a part time shuttle bus driver?

To become a part-time shuttle bus driver, you typically need a valid driver's license, a clean driving record, and sometimes a commercial driver's license (CDL) or passenger endorsement. Employers may require background checks, a minimum age requirement, and good customer service skills. Prior driving experience and knowledge of safety procedures are also beneficial.
